In the gripping second episode of “The Real Murders on Elm Street,” titled “And We Have Serial Killers,” viewers are in for a chilling ride as the investigation unfolds around a mysterious fire. Airing at 9:00 PM on Monday, September 16, 2024, on Investigation Discovery, this episode dives deep into a shocking crime scene that has left the community on edge.

When a house on Elm Street goes up in flames, firefighters rush in to battle the blaze, only to make a horrifying discovery inside: two bodies impaled with swords. The male victim is quickly identified, but the female victim’s identity remains shrouded in mystery, raising numerous questions about the circumstances surrounding the crime.
